Locking the SIM Card When SIM Lock is enabled, your phone works only with the current SIM card. To use another SIM card, you must enter the SIM lock password. 1. On the Home screen, select Start ➔ More ➔ Settings ➔ Security ➔ Enable SIM Lock and press the key. 2. Enter a password for your SIM card and press the Done soft key. 3. Re-enter the password for confirmation and press the Done soft key. Enabling the SIM PIN When SIM PIN is enabled, you must enter your PIN supplied with your phone each time you turn the phone on or insert the current SIM card into another device. Consequently, any person who does not have your PIN cannot use your phone without your approval. 1. On the Home screen, select Start ➔ More ➔ Settings ➔ Security ➔ Enable SIM PIN and press the key. 2. Enter the PIN and press the Done soft key. Changing PIN2 A PIN 2 is used for certain functions supported by the SIM card. You can change the PIN2 supplied with your SIM card to a new one. 1. On the Home screen, select Start ➔ More ➔ Settings ➔ Security ➔ Change PIN2 and press the key. 2. Enter the current PIN2 in the Old PIN field, then a new PIN in the New PIN field, and re-enter the new PIN in the Confirm new PIN field. 3. Press the Done soft key. Understanding Your Phone 23
